US 11,865,968 B2
Vehicle lamp and lamp control module
Yuichi Miyashita, Shizuoka (JP)
Assigned to KOITO MANUFACTURING CO., LTD., Tokyo (JP)
Filed by KOITO MANUFACTURING CO., LTD., Tokyo (JP)
Filed on Sep. 16, 2021, as Appl. No. 17/477,164.
Claims priority of application No. 2020-155749 (JP), filed on Sep. 16, 2020.
Prior Publication US 2022/0080882 A1, Mar. 17, 2022
Int. Cl. H05B 45/10 (2020.01); B60Q 1/34 (2006.01)
CPC B60Q 1/343 (2013.01) [H05B 45/10 (2020.01)] 8 Claims

1. A vehicle lamp comprising:
a turn signal lamp light source including a plurality of light emitting elements independently controllable to be turned on and off;
a nonvolatile memory that stores a parameter for independent control of the plurality of light emitting elements;
a signal processing device configured to generate, based on the parameter, a plurality of turn-on commands independently indicating turn-on states of the plurality of light emitting elements at each time point by executing a software program; and
a drive circuit configured to drive each of the plurality of light emitting elements independently based on the plurality of turn-on commands,
wherein the plurality of light emitting elements of the turn signal lamp light source independently blink in response to a turn synchronization signal from a vehicle that alternately repeats at high and low in a predetermined cycle.
